Rylands bring in Salford City youngster

Warrington Rylands have brought in young Salford City winger Kelly N’Mai on an initial one-month loan.

The 18-year-old made 10 appearances last season, becoming the first player in the Ammies’ academy to play for the men’s team, but has only featured once so far in 2022-23.

He featured sporadically in pre-season, including in their win at Rylands in July.

Now he will spend the next four weeks at Gorsey Lane, with Rylands currently eighth, one point outside the play-offs.

N’Mai goes straight into contention for Saturday’s game against Stafford Rangers.
